Understanding the Symbolism of Tigers in Dreams
Dreaming of tigers can evoke a mix of emotions, ranging from awe to fear. In cultures around the world, tigers symbolize strength, ferocity, and independence. To see a tiger in your dream may represent your own power or challenges you face in your waking life.
According to traditional interpretations, such dreams can also reflect our inner fears, suggesting that we confront hidden aspects of ourselves. This deep connection between your personal experiences and the majestic creature underscores the importance of understanding what a tiger might signify in your life. Throughout history, tigers have been revered and respected, embodying the raw forces of nature as well as the complex feelings associated with power dynamics.
In today's fast-paced world, these dreams can also serve as reminders to embrace one's own strength and to face personal challenges head-on. Let us delve deeper into this fascinating topic.

- Leopard:
(Leopard) In a dream, a tiger represents a tyrant, an unjust ruler, or an avowed enemy. Killing a tiger in a dream means vanquishing such an enemy. Eating the flesh of a tiger in a dream means money, profits and honor.
Riding on a tiger in a dream means power and sovereignty. A tiger inside one’s house in a dream represents an insolent person who attacks one’s family. Seeing a tiger or a leopard in one’s dream means receiving money from an insolent or an artful person.
A struggle with a tiger in a dream means fighting with an insolent person. Tiger’s bite in a dream represents damage caused by such a person. A tiger in a dream also represents either a man or a woman.
It also represents deceit, trickery, an illness, or eye irritation. Tigress milk in a dream represents enmity. Seeing a tiger in a dream also could mean repenting from sin.
- Lynx:
(Cheetah; Panther) Lynx, a cheetah, or a panther in a dream represent might, exaltation, cuddling and coquetry, along with anger, rage and enmity. A lynx in a dream also represents an enemy who does not show either his enmity nor friendliness. Fighting with a lynx in a dream means fighting with someone with such qualities and character.
Using a lynx to hunt with in a dream means prosperity and might.

- Banal:
A cat in a dream represents a book of records, one’s share from a business, an inheritance, or his work. A cat in a dream also means shunning off one’s husband, wife or children, or it could mean a fight, theft, adultery, disloyalty, eavesdropping, backbiting or bearing a child from adultery, a bastard child, or it could represent a gentle speaking person, a toadying person or someone who desires to be accepted by others, and should he find an opportune moment, he will spoil everyone’s peace. A cat in a dream also represents a banal woman who likes herself.
If a cat steels something from her master, it means that he may pay a fine, have a fight with his relatives or children, and it could mean a robbery. A wildcat in a dream means adversities, toiling and a wretched life. Selling a cat in a dream means spending one’s money.
The scratch of a cat in a dream means that one will be betrayed by his servant. The bite of a cat in a dream represents a hoaxer or a crooked woman. It is also said that a cat’s bite in a dream means an illness that will last one full year.

Practical Insights for Understanding Your Tiger Dreams
- Reflect on Your Feelings
When you dream of a tiger, take a moment to journal your emotions surrounding the dream. What did the tiger represent to you? Was it a source of fear, admiration, or something else?
By reflecting on your feelings, you may uncover underlying issues or strengths you need to acknowledge in your waking life. This practice not only helps to clarify your thoughts but also empowers you to address any fears or challenges symbolized by the tiger. Remember, our dreams often serve as a window into our subconscious, allowing us to better understand our true selves.
- Consider the Tiger's Behavior
Pay close attention to the behavior of the tiger in your dream. Was it aggressive, calm, or playful? Each action can provide significant insights into your current life circumstances.
For example, a calm tiger may suggest you have overcome a fear or are coming to peace with a challenging situation. In contrast, an aggressive tiger could indicate an upcoming conflict or that you’re being challenged in your waking life. Analyze these behaviors as reflections of your mental and emotional state, and use this understanding to strategize your responses to real-life challenges.

FAQs
- What does it mean to dream of a tiger chasing you?
Dreaming of a tiger chasing you may signify an overwhelming fear or challenge in your waking life. The tiger's pursuit can represent aspects of yourself that you are trying to escape. This type of dream often encourages you to confront your fears directly rather than avoiding them, as this can lead to personal growth and empowerment.
- Can dreaming of a tiger indicate a positive change?
Yes, dreaming of a tiger can also symbolize personal power and strength, suggesting that you are ready to take control of a situation in your life. If the tiger is calm or peaceful in your dream, it can indicate confidence and the potential for positive changes. Embracing your inner strength can pave the way for new opportunities or transformations.
- Why do I feel afraid when I dream of tigers?
Fear in dreams involving tigers often reflects inner conflicts or anxieties you are experiencing in your waking life. Such feelings can stem from unresolved issues or challenges that you face. Recognizing this fear as a message can help you develop strategies to confront and overcome these obstacles, guiding you toward resolution.
- What if I dream of playing with a tiger?
Dreaming of playing with a tiger can symbolize a harmonious relationship with your inner strength and courage. It reflects a balance between embracing your powerful attributes while feeling safe. This dream suggests that you are in a phase of self-acceptance, recognizing that your strengths can be nurturing and joyful parts of your life.
